Beverly Anne (Tucek) Rachal died at the age of 85 on the morning of May 18, 2021 in her home of 58 years surrounded by family and friends after battling Alzheimer’s Disease for many years. Born on Friday, September 13, 1935 in Detroit, Michigan, she moved with her family to Bossier City, Louisiana when she was 13 years old. She attended Bossier High School and met the love of her life, Jack Reid Rachal, at age 16, with whom she eloped to Hope, Arkansas in a daring nighttime adventure aided by his brother. The two of them followed his work around the country as a telephone pole sprayer and instilling in them a love of travel. During this time, they started a family with the addition of three children before putting down roots back in Shreveport, where they built the home in which they lived for the rest of their lives. They did not stay stationary, however, as “Bev” completed her GED and began working as a bookkeeper while raising her family. Upon Jack’s retirement, they became world travelers across Europe, Australia and New Zealand, but they loved little more than to load up their RV and hit the road for months at a time exploring as much of North America as they could discover via the open road. Beverly loved telling stories of their adventures with her children and grandchildren, often arguing the details with Jack and bringing laughs with her embellishments. She liked to rib her family to get a rise out of them while turning to another with a little wink to show it was all in good fun. She took the business of her household and responsibilities seriously, but rarely did it interfere with her ability to have a good time.
